Happened to hear this song Lonely Voyage, performed by Ha Yun-ju, a traditional South Korean guk ak (literally country music) singer, who lends her Han style to a contemporary love lost genre, with striking results. Han is a unique Korean style reflecting deep sorrow, regret, or resentment. The song is several years old from the drama Married World OST. Original artist is Kim Yoon-a. Ha, the singer at the link below, sang this at a competition. Ha's performance is clearly superior to the original.

This is my interpretation of some verses chosen by contemporary singers for their performances from the traditional Korean "minyo" or folk song. The original version depicts the abandoned lover, who laments her fate and describes the different ways she recalls her lost love. The original is substantially longer. My interpretation is entirely subjective. There is no consensus on the title's exact meaning in English, which is in the refrain, and subject to some dispute. The lyrics are archaic, or ambiguous in several parts. I hadn't seen any good translations. I think that perhaps due to the song being an oral tradition. Nevertheless, the song's popular appeal in South Korea causes many traditional and popular singers to perform Han O Bek Nyun.

So this is the Vietnam War era South Korean pop hit performed originally by singer Kim Chu-ja. The lyrics are credited to Yoo Ho ( 유호 ) with melody credited to Shin Joong-hyun ( 신중현 ). Singer Cho Gwan-oo performed the song in more recent times. This later performance took place on a talent competition program won by guitar player/singer Kang Jimin. Kang performs many US popular songs as well, mostly oldies. I saw another youtube of this same performance by Kang Jimin dated 2017. That's her father celebrating with her onstage.*

*link- https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=7odwz5vodCY

Kim Chu-ja's original performance is 1969, on an album with a patriotic theme. The album fits in with the militaristic culture back then during the Park Chung-hee dictatorship. I like her version, but her recording has a night club or cabaret sound to it, which i guess was popular back then but sounds dated now. Kang Jimin's more contemporary style is mellow and pleasant sounding I think. I had a copy of Kim Chu-ja's album years ago, and would play it driving cross country. I knew the words by heart. When I tried to translate it to English, I had some trouble because the subject in some the lyric phrases isn't expressed clearly, often the case in Korean. That also gives the listener the option of subjective interpretation. So I assumed the context to be the theme of the soldier who left home to fight a war and didn't come back. Other youtube video presentations of the song confirmed this to be the case. There is also more upbeat patriotic song on Kim's same album, called (Sunburned) Sergeant Kim back from Vietnam (월남에서 돌아온 새까만 김상사 ) which makes the context clear.

정읍사 ( 井邑詞 )

정읍사 ( 井邑詞 ) Jeong Eub Tale ( 달님이여 ) Dear Moon by ( 이정표 ) Lee Jung-pyo

This song is believed to have originated in the Baek Jae Kingdom of southern Korea in the late 8th Century as a folk song. It is a prayer by a wife to the moon at night to keep safe her itinerant husband away on business from the hazards of travel in the darkness. The song is reputed to be the only song surviving from the Baek Jae period. The Korean wiki says it was recorded in the late 15th century during the Chosun Dynasty in the Illustrated Text of Traditional Music. ( 악학궤범 ) ( 樂學軌範 )

The original lyrics of the Baek Jae folk song aren't known. The lyrics later recorded during the Chosun dynasty are an old form of Hangul that need to be reinterpreted for modern listeners. Reportedly the song was performed at court in both the Goryeo and Chosun periods. This is Lee Jung-pyo's performance of the her interpretation of the lyrics and composition. A purpose of the song was to relieve the concern for a loved one away from home and assert one's faithfulness as a means of comfort. Lee's recent performance is intended to provide similar relief in these difficult times.

Lee Jung-pyo is the singer/composer.

The lyrics of a poem ascribed to King Yuri ( 19 BCE- 18CE ) of the Goguryeo Kingdom ( 고구려 高句麗 ) from the three kingdoms period. The song title is Hwang Jo Ga 황조가 , Yellow Bird Song according to the Hanja explanation in naver.com. This was the theme song from the KBS historical drama Kingdom of the Wind 바람의 나라 (2008). The series was a rendition of the Jumong legend. Jumong was the founder of the Goguryeo Kingdom. Yuri was the second king.

It's theme is about the lingering nostalgia for the life before coming of age and leaving the family home town ( 고 향 ) in the country. As usual, my interpretation of the lyrics is subjective and may includes some mistakes. A literal translation is awkward and difficult. The reference to 망향초 is an allusion to an old Chinese Han Dynasty legend of a beautiful princess 왕소군 exiled to a foreign land, who died there; it also literally means "nostaglia flower" the wild rose that sprouted on her grave near the border of her home country, where she wished to be buried. She died young due to her homesickness. Thus the line's reference to the "situation of the wild rose" probably refers to fleeing Koreans during the Japanese colonial period perhaps to join the independence movement.

눈물 젖은 두만강 Tumen River of Tears

This is a Han style piece, a traditional song, an old favorite. Han is the style of deep haunting sorrow that is one aspect of Korean culture. The Tumen River forms the northeast border of North Korea with China and Russia.

Below is the URL for Song So Hee's performance of Tumen River of Tears. White attire is worn after death. According to a note in the historical Kdrama, 이몽 I Mong, (Different Dreams) episode 14, the song was about the grief of a widow, Kim Jeung Son, who discovered after searching for years, that her husband, Moon Chang Hak, an independence movement fighter in the Heroic Corps ( 의열단; 義烈團 ), had been executed by the Japanese in 1923. The note explains the composer, Lee Si Wu, heard her crying all night in a inn near the river and composed the melody to emulate her lament.

https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=7eliY0dFAEY.

The song is a tribute to the Korean Independence Movement and the sacrifices made by Korean families during the Japanese occupation,* especially the separation of loved ones. A review of the Song So Hee performance by The Herald noted the original (1939) performer Kim Jung Gu, 김정구. In more recent times, the song is also performed in connection with events related to separated families from the Korean conflict. The popular rendition of the song title is Tearful Tumen River. My longed for love, perhaps better translated my longed for beloved, is understood to mean my beloved Korea, in occupation lexicon.
